About This Book
Discover the fascinating world of dinosaurs and learn how these giant creatures once roamed the Earth. Explore the clues left behind in fossils and find out the mystery behind their disappearance in a fun and easy-to-understand way. Perfect for young dinosaur fans eager to uncover prehistoric secrets!
